Breguet: Art and Innovation in The watchmaking industry explores a brief history from the watch and clock maker Breguet. Their cutting-edge improvements changed the character of private timekeeping, and also the exhibition includes shows explaining we’ve got the technology that gained Abraham-Louis Breguet his sobriquet as “the father of contemporary horology.”

From the origins in Paris in 1775, Breguet advanced great technical developments like the self-winding watch, the very first watch, the repeating mechanism, and, most particularly, the tourbillon-an innovative movement that neutralizes the side effects of gravity on pocket watches. Breguet performed a vital role within the good reputation for the watchmaking industry, raising the craft to the zenith by creating carefully made watches which were an enjoyment to deal with and employ.

bregeut-ref-4215-1365490489

The business’s status for resourcefulness, along with the reliability and portability of their watches, brought to Breguet’s watches being considered objects of effective prestige, worn through the effective and elite in Europe, including Napoleon Bonaparte, Tsar Alexander I, and Full Victoria. The favourite Breguet watch associated with an ecu monarch may be the world-famous “Marie-Antoinette” pocket watch. This remarkable piece required 44 many years to make called the most complicated watch of their time. Throughout the 1800s, Breguet broadened its business into nations beyond France, delivering elegant watches to clients in Europe, Russia, and also the U. S. States. Today Breguet is really a title known around the world.

Co-curated by Martin Chapman, curator responsible for European decorative arts and sculpture, and Emmanuel Breguet, V. P. and Mind of Patrimony and Proper Growth and development of Montres Breguet S.A., this presentation in the Legion of Recognition features greater than 80 objects. A scholarly catalogue is going to be released through the Fine Arts Museums to coincide using the exhibition.
